Two underground trains collide in Washington D.C

23 Jun 2009
Two Metrorail trains collided in the Washington, D.C., area at approximately 1700 local time yesterday. The collision involved a six-car train and another train travelling on the Red Line above ground between the Takoma Park and Fort Totten stations, near the D.C./Maryland border. Reports indicate that at least seven people were killed and more than 75 others were injured. Speculation has focused on a possible failure in the signal system and operator error. While minimal Red Line service has resumed, there have been reports of significant delays throughout the Metrorail system. Metro officials have urged commuters to avoid the Red Line.
